NXP S9S12P128J0MQK: A Comprehensive Technical Overview of the 16-bit HCS12 Microcontroller

Release date:2026-05-15 Number of clicks:115

NXP S9S12P128J0MQK: A Comprehensive Technical Overview of the 16-bit HCS12 Microcontroller

The NXP S9S12P128J0MQK represents a key component within the widely adopted HCS12 Family of 16-bit microcontrollers. Designed for robust performance in demanding automotive, industrial, and consumer applications, this MCU combines a powerful CPU12 core with a rich set of integrated peripherals, making it a versatile solution for complex embedded control tasks.

At the heart of the S9S12P128J0MQK lies the high-performance 16-bit CPU12 core, capable of operating at bus speeds of up to 25 MHz. This core maintains a high degree of compatibility with the earlier HC12 family while offering enhanced performance and new instruction set features. The microcontroller is built on a 0.25µm CMOS technology, which provides an optimal balance of processing speed, power consumption, and integration density.

A defining feature of this variant is its substantial 128KB of on-chip Flash memory. This non-volatile memory supports read/program/erase operations over the full operating voltage range, enabling flexible in-application programming (IAP) and bootloading capabilities. For data storage, the device includes 8KB of RAM, ensuring efficient temporary data handling and stack operations, along with 2KB of EEPROM for storing critical data that must be retained without power and updated frequently.

The peripheral set integrated into the S9S12P128J0MQK is extensive and tailored for control-oriented applications. It includes:

Enhanced Capture Timer (ECT): A sophisticated timing system for generating timing delays, measuring input waveforms, and producing output pulses.

Serial Communication Interfaces (SCI/SPI): Multiple serial channels (up to 2 SCIs and 2 SPIs) for asynchronous (RS-232, RS-485) and synchronous serial communication with other peripherals or systems.

Controller Area Network (MSCAN): A full-featured CAN 2.0 A/B module essential for automotive and industrial networking, supporting complex, high-integrity multi-node communication.

8-Channel 10-bit Analog-to-Digital Converter (ADC): For accurate interfacing with analog sensors and signals from the physical world.

Pulse-Width Modulation (PWM) Modules: 8 channels for precise control of motors, LEDs, and other actuators.

The device operates within a wide voltage range of 2.35V to 5.5V and is specified over an industrial temperature range of -40°C to +125°C, underscoring its suitability for harsh environments. It is offered in an 80-pin QFP package (MQK), which provides a compact footprint while offering a sufficient number of I/O pins for complex applications.

Development is supported by a mature ecosystem of tools, including evaluation boards, in-circuit emulators, and comprehensive software suites like NXP's CodeWarrior IDE, which features a highly optimized C compiler, simplifying the coding and debugging process.

ICGOODFIND: The NXP S9S12P128J0MQK stands as a robust and highly integrated 16-bit microcontroller. Its powerful CPU12 core, large memory complement (128KB Flash, 8KB RAM, 2KB EEPROM), and comprehensive set of automotive-grade peripherals—including CAN, PWM, and ADC—make it an exceptionally capable and reliable choice for designers tackling challenging embedded control problems in the automotive and industrial sectors.

Keywords: 16-bit Microcontroller, HCS12 Family, On-chip Flash Memory, Controller Area Network (CAN), Automotive Applications.

Home
TELEPHONE CONSULTATION
Whatsapp
BOM RFQ